LEARN HOW TO GENERATE AN INNOVATION STRATEGY THAT CAPTURES GENUINE VALUE

Overview

Fifty years ago, the average life expectancy of a Fortune 500 firm was more than 75 years... now, it is less than 15. In today’s fast-paced, converging world, it is a simple truth that sustained innovation is a necessity not only to thrive but also to survive.

However, for most firms, while the imperative to innovate and refresh an offering is understood, the strategies and processes associated with innovation remain vague and not are professionally managed. As a result, most firms are unable to innovate effectively and thus create genuine new value. What’s more, even among those who are able to create new value, few are able to capture it effectively and integrate innovation into their .

This is the challenge that lies at the heart of the Managing Innovation Strategically programme - the critical importance of pairing the pursuit of innovation with a proper strategic approach.

Essentially an overview of our entire Innovation Suite offering, the programme is designed to provide managers and leaders who hold a responsibility within their organisations for strategic leadership with an understanding of the concepts around innovation.

In this programme, we will learn why firms struggle to create and capture new value. We will share a number of concepts on how to implement innovation in an organisation and develop a set of practical tools and concepts that you can apply to your business.

Topics

• If innovation is so important to survival and success, why aren’t organisations able to do it on a sustained basis?• Are you using your customers effectively to innovate? Are you harnessing the power of users?• How can you make your organisation and yourself more creative?• Once you have identified possibilities, how do you create a balanced portfolio of innovation projects, to allocate resources optimally?• How do you manage innovative development projects?• How do you disrupt your competitors through innovative business models?• How do you operationalise new business models?• How do you capture the value you have created?• Are you developing the right complementary assets to capture value?• How do you enhance the likelihood of your product’s success in the market?

Benefits

• Have the tools and techniques of managing innovation• Be able to apply innovation in your organisations to enhance performance• Identify process from innovation to create competitive advantage• Understand the factors to support creativity and innovation• Understand the innovation implementation process and how best to organise innovation

DRIVE INNOVATION AND IMPACT BY TAPPING IN TO YOUR ENTREPRENEURIAL SPIRIT

Overview

To thrive in today’s volatile business environment requires organisations of any size to systematically challenge assumptions, recognise the non-obvious, and generate alternatives their customers value - the kind of behaviour most often associated with agile start-ups.

Indeed, more traditional “legacy” businesses increasingly need to reinvigorate their offerings with the agility typical of entrepreneurs. But how can businesses sustain an entrepreneurial spirit while operating at scale?

Our programme Building & Sustaining an Entrepreneurial Culture offers tangible and actionable answers to this question, having been designed to empower decision-makers to quickly and effectively respond to the specific contingencies they face in their organisations. Delegates will address such issues as the creation of a context within which entrepreneurialism is nurtured and contagious, or the most appropriate organisational structures and processes to generate sustainable growth.

This programme builds upon the latest research and a combined experience of over 30 years of organisational support for entrepreneurial and growing organisations to introduce applicable frameworks and tools that help senior executives create a context within which entrepreneurialism is nurtured and contagious.

Topics

• What it means to be entrepreneurial for an established or growing organisation, and the core elements that make organisations entrepreneurial• What are the challenges and barriers to cultivating entrepreneurialism? How do they weigh against the benefits of entrepreneurialism?• How can an organisation eliminate the blind-spots associated with inertia and/or past success to see opportunities through a different lens?• How can organisations adapt the dimensions of their corporate culture to exhibit the flexibility of new ventures?• What role can the broader business ecosystem play in the organisational efforts to be nimble and effective?• How can organisations effectively recognise the need to strategically pivot and adapt?

Benefits

• Gain the diagnostic capability to identify the root cause of current deficiencies in innovation• Equip yourself with a rich management toolbox to identify performance challenges and business opportunities, scope them, and realise solutions• Understand the framework to balance the benefits of top-down strategic guidance and bottom-up exploration• Learn how to define, run and analyse business experiments and recognise when and how to pivot

UNLEASHING THE POWER OF CREATIVITY TO INJECT NEW ENERGY INTO A BUSINESS

Overview

The creation of new and useful ideas at all levels of an organisation can be a catalyst for dynamic change and valuable innovation. Indeed, according to IBM 60 per cent of top executives worldwide name ‘creativity’ as their top priority. However, many business leaders still struggle to embrace the potential of creativity.

The Cambridge Creativity Lab has been created to help you foster and harness creativity within your organisation. An intensive two-day experience focused on stimulating personal and collective creativity and on better understanding the importance and relevance of creativity in business, this practical, hands-on workshop is designed to be an introduction to creativity and its practical range of application within a business context and beyond.

This programme provides a fresh perspective to a management approach that lies outside the traditional business school curriculum. It also addresses prejudices about creativity (such as, “I’m really not creative”, “creativity cannot be taught”, “we don’t have time to think creatively”, etc.), and introduces, discusses, and puts into practice concepts, models, frameworks, methods and tools of creativity to help participants address live real-world business challenges.

The learning experience within the Cambridge Creativity Lab is designed to be inspiring, stimulating and disruptive, and culminates in the “creative-hack-a-thon”, a creative pitch competition with presentations delivered to the programme facilitators and leading associates of Cambridge Judge Business School.

Topics

• What is creativity in business? The importance and relevance of creativity in business and how ideas can create change that leads to innovation.• Experimenting with and valuing your own creative skillset and potential allowing you to assess how you can add value in a resourceful and inventive way• Best practices for stimulating creativity at individual, team and organisational level in order to achieve organisational goals• Stimuli and obstacles to individual, team and organisational creativity – debunk the myths• Concepts, models, frameworks, methods and tools to manage business endeavours creatively

Benefits

• Gain hands-on experience of creativity and how to promote new ideas in your organisation• Experiment with creativity in a safe environment in order to understand the tools and dynamics required• Take the opportunity to learn about your own creativity and that of your collaborators and organisation by observing your own behaviours and reflecting on those around you in action• Acquire the tool and skills to understand how to capture new ideas and seek out challenges in order to both broaden your knowledge and skills, and manage your surroundings• Develop your creative leadership skills• Understand the frameworks required to nurture a creative culture

LEAD THE CHARGE AS YOUR ORGANISATION EMBRACES DIGITAL EVOLUTION

Overview

Over the last decade, ‘born digital’ companies such as Facebook, Google and Alibaba have led the way as key innovators in their industry - the challenge of the business world today is for organisations across a wide range of sectors to transform their strategy and ways of organising through digital technologies to be innovative and competitive.

For a senior manager, this requires creative confidence. It also requires there to be a change in the way the organisation itself operates, transforming itself from the inside-out to embrace the business ecosystem.

This programme - Digital Innovation & Transformation - has been created to equip managers with the tools they need to fully lead this change and move their organisation though the next stage of its digital evolution.

As well as provide methodologies and frameworks, we also identify ways in which new technologies can be adapted into the culture and allow people at all levels of the business to understand and use them in ways that benefit the organisation. For example, we shall look at the Internet of Things and its implications for smart manufacturing.

We adopt a multi-facetted approach, developing capabilities on digital innovation, designing services, ecosystem leadership, creative cross-functional teams, and successfully transitioning to a digital enterprise.

Topics

• Developing a vision for digital innovation for your organisation• Build your leadership skills and practices to be effective in a digital organisation• Re-inventing your strategy and value creating approaches to take advantage of digital• Developing your team to work creatively• Transforming your organisation and managing resistance to change in embracing digital• Effectively digitising business processes to meet changing customer behaviours• Creatively designing and scaling-up digital services for customers and across the ecosystem

Benefits

• Have the tools and techniques for designing innovative digital solutions• Be able to apply digital innovation frameworks to enhance strategy and competitiveness• Develop cross functional teams for successful innovation • Understand how to manage the transition in becoming a more effective digital organisation • Develop a leadership strategy to successfully scale innovation across your ecosystem.

... that flows from our rich history

Founded in 1209, ours is one of the world’s oldest universities and a leading global research institute. The University of Cambridge is not a centre of teaching, it is a centre of learning – and there is a subtle, yet critical, difference.

The former is a place where existing knowledge is passed on, from master to student. The latter is a place where knowledge is shared among peers in a process of collaboration that leads to new thinking.

This is the approach that has made The University Of Cambridge the world-leading research institution it is today, one that sits at the centre of global knowledge network and boasts no less than 107 Nobel laureates among its alumni.

Here at the Cambridge Judge Business School we embrace that heritage. We exist at the interface between academia and delivery, applying new knowledge to practical, real-world situations and collaborating with the business world to create genuine impact.
